Karnak Temple
When you arrive in Luxor, you'll check in to your 5-star Nile cruise ship. Then you'll explore Karnak, the world's largest temple complex, including the Temple of Amun, Temple of Luxor with Ramses II granite statues, the Avenue of Sphinxes, Hypostyle Hall, Obelisks of Queen Hatshepsut and Tuthmosis, Temple of Amon with lotus and papyrus designs, Granite Scarab of Amenophis III, and the Sacred Lake. An optional sound and light show is available in the evening if you're interested.

Valley of the Kings, Hatshepsut Temple, Colossi of Memnon
You'll spend the day exploring the West Bank of the Nile, starting with the Valley of the Kings where you can see 64 tombs and chambers of varying complexity. Next, you'll see the Colossi of Memnon, two colossal stone statues of Pharaoh Amenhotep III, and the Temple of Queen Hatshepsut at Deir el Bahari. An optional sunrise hot air balloon ride is available early morning if you want it. Enjoy a leisurely dinner onboard the cruise ship as you sail towards Edfu.

Edfu Temple and Kom Ombo Temple
You'll explore Edfu Temple, which honors the falcon god Horus and is one of Egypt's best-preserved temples. After that, grab a leisurely lunch onboard, then continue sailing towards Kom Ombo. Visit Kom Ombo Temple, which is dedicated to the twin deities Sobek and Horus.

High Dam, Temple of Philae, Optional Nubian Village
Start with breakfast, then take a comprehensive guided tour of Aswan. You'll visit the High Dam, an impressive engineering feat, and the Temple of Philae, dedicated to the goddesses Isis and Hathor. In the afternoon, you have the option to visit a Nubian village to see the vibrant culture and traditions of the Nubian people and spend time with locals.
